The History of Classic Slots

This mechanical device featured three spinning reels and 5 symbols: diamonds, hearts, spades, a horseshoe, and the Liberty Bell. Players would put in a nickel, pull a lever, and hope to align 3 matching symbols for a win. This created an engaging experience that captured the fascination of numerous people.


As the popularity of the Liberty Bell grew, so did advancements in design and mechanics. By the beginning of the 20th century, slot machines became a common sight in pubs and restaurants, often referred to as "one-armed bandits." These machines offered players the thrill of chance with the ease of a coin-operated device. The advent of fruit symbols such as cherries, lemon, and plums became a norm, further strengthening their identity as classic slots. These symbols were not only appealing but also socially relevant at the time, adding to the excitement of gambling.


The development of traditional slots continued over the decades, with the launch of electric slot machines in the 1960s, which allowed for more intricate designs and features. As tech progressed, the transition from classic to electronic paved the way for more sophisticated gameplay elements while retaining that nostalgic core. Regardless of these changes, the essence of traditional slots—simplicity and excitement—remains prevalent, keeping the tradition alive for many generations of gamblers.
